Transaction 4ff17a926c944234930b521e60517048c8013a84af6533209c8fbb35c26f3844
2 Input
2 Outputs
- 4ff17a926c944234930b521e60517048c8013a84af6533209c8fbb35c26f3844:0
- 4ff17a926c944234930b521e60517048c8013a84af6533209c8fbb35c26f3844:1
value 1000000
address 1BACuZDoERxTo5m5UaTk2tHydtGm8Y2FjF
value 1007655
address 18gScqMx2aLxydttVCbSwoRV6gXNxf3Wy6